Abstract
Advances in the design, realization, and investigation of the clinotron, which is a high-power modification of the backward-wave oscillator, are reviewed. A series of clinotron tubes operating throughout the millimeter and submillimeter wave bands is presented, and the results of their testing are reported. Approaches to the development of clinotron based synthesized sources for THz regions are described. Practical realizations of such sources are presented. Potentials of the clinotron for further upgrading efficiency, output power, and operating frequency are examined.
